Batch API Cost Calculator

Trade 24h turnaround for 50% cost reduction. Estimate savings on non-urgent workloads.

Real-time Pricing

$3 / $15 per 1M

Batch Pricing

$1.5 / $7.5 per 1M

Scenario Presets

Job Configuration

10,000

Total API calls in your batch job

11M
500

Average prompt size per request

110,000
100

Average response size per request

14,000

Volume Summary

Total Input
5.0M tokens
Total Output
1.0M tokens
Cost / Record (Real-time)
$0.003
Cost / Record (Batch)
$0.0015

Total Savings

$15.00

50% cheaper with Batch API

Batch Discount 50% off

Time vs Money

Real-time API

Instant response

$30.00

Batch API

~24 hour turnaround

$15.00

Cost Comparison

Real-time $30.00
Batch $15.00

When Does Batch API Make Sense?

Good fit

  • Overnight data pipelines
  • Bulk document classification
  • Embedding generation jobs
  • Weekly report generation
  • Fine-tuning data prep

Poor fit

  • Real-time user chatbots
  • Latency-sensitive APIs
  • Interactive tools (<1s SLA)
  • Streaming output required

Rule of thumb

Batch pays off when:

  • >10,000 records/job
  • 24h latency acceptable
  • Savings > $10/run

Track batch pricing discounts

Alert when batch discount changes · Free · Double opt-in · Unsubscribe anytime